Ordinals
beta
Sat 1400989950573456
decimal
350395.2450573456
degree
0°140395′1627″2450573456‴
percentile
66.7138072435498%
name
dxsheegqwlt
cycle
0
epoch
1
period
173
block
350395
offset
2450573456
timestamp
2015-04-02 15:48:16 UTC
rarity
common
prev
next